@Dylanwade_
11 ай бұрын
@@katecrabb1958 you can! But they only give you 3:2 1:1 and 16:9. 4:5 to replicate 6x7 film and 4:3 to replicate 645 would be ideal. Especially because instagrams vertical is 4:5 it just makes sense for SOOC jpg purposes.

@abelardojeda
Жыл бұрын
The main reason to choose an EVF/OVF over the screen is the extra detail (you are not seeing a tiny screen (because of the distance between to your face and your camera or phone). The other reason are sunny days, definitely better to use the EVF/OVF. Third reason for some people (like me): if you use glasses for eye strain, the screen is useless, as streets photographers can’t waste time taking on and off the glasses to watch the screen and then the street over and over, thus the EVF is a better choice.
